Abstract

Beliefs are the major source of individual and social behavior. Those who believe that the existence belongs to God and Man returns to him in next world has a different behavior from those who fail to adopt such a belief. Shahid Soleimani is not an exception to this rule. Thus, the current study is intended to examine the effect of Shahid Soleimani’s interpretation and understanding of the universe on his social behavior. The main questions is that how his ontology has resulted in his jihadi social life. To answer this question a descriptive-analytical method using theme analysis is employed. To this aim, a collection of his speeches, his will (testament) and interviews were collected as the samples of the study and analyzed through open coding. It was revealed that monotheism is the central theme is Shahid Soleimani’s view which has affected all domains of his social and individual life. That is why his behavior becomes an innovative and valuable model for the 21 century audience.
